Saturday, August 25th, 2007A person’s perception of work, rather than the nature of the work, is more important in determining the level of satisfaction the work provides.
Jobs, Careers, and Calling
We spend at least a third of our adult lives at our work. It’s
not surprising then that research studies show a person’s happiness and satisfaction in life is a function of how they perceive work. People perceive their vocation in three general categories: jobs, careers, and calling.
